summaryrefslogtreecommitdiffstats
path: root/src
Commit message (Collapse)AuthorAgeFilesLines
* [g3dvl] move stuff from flush into own functionsChristian König2010-11-111-37/+59
|
* [g3dvl] remove empty block handling for nowChristian König2010-11-118-76/+5
| | | | | Maybe this isn't going into the right direction, but it makes handling the code easier for now.
* [g3dvl] use only one vertex element for ycbcr z-coordChristian König2010-11-111-39/+26
|
* [g3dvl] move the rest of the calculations into the vertex shaderChristian König2010-11-112-138/+124
|
* [g3dvl] cleanup vert_stream_0Christian König2010-11-111-59/+35
|
* [g3dvl] use clamp to border for empty block handlingChristian König2010-11-101-31/+32
|
* [g3dvl] move to 3D textures for y cb crChristian König2010-11-101-94/+84
|
* [g3dvl] again rework vertex shader a bitChristian König2010-11-101-17/+34
|
* [g3dvl] workaround for motion vertical field selectionChristian König2010-11-091-8/+23
|
* [g3dvl] start handling motion_vertical_field_selectChristian König2010-11-092-0/+6
|
* [g3dvl] cleanup naming convention and commentsChristian König2010-11-061-20/+27
|
* [g3dvl] motion type depends on picture structure not dct typeChristian König2010-11-061-7/+8
|
* [g3dvl] simplyfy shaders and fix bugsChristian König2010-11-051-23/+16
|
* [g3dvl] it finally starts to look like a badly deinterlaced videoChristian König2010-11-051-17/+55
|
* [g3dvl] move scaling to macroblocksize into vertex shaderChristian König2010-11-051-63/+57
|
* [g3dvl] move vertex normalisation into vertex shaderChristian König2010-11-042-34/+44
|
* [g3dvl] rework shader a bitChristian König2010-11-041-219/+56
|
* Fix zero block handling for field based mcChristian König2010-11-031-26/+39
|
* First try of field based mcChristian König2010-10-301-19/+190
|
* Merge branch 'master' of ssh://git.freedesktop.org/git/mesa/mesa into pipe-videoChristian König2010-10-281122-28775/+34236
|\ | | | | | | | | Conflicts: src/gallium/include/pipe/p_format.h
| * gallium: Avoid using __doc__ in python scripts.José Fonseca2010-10-283-6/+6
| |
| * st/mesa: Silence uninitialized variable warning.Vinson Lee2010-10-281-0/+4
| | | | | | | | | | | | Fixes this GCC warning. state_tracker/st_program.c: In function 'st_print_shaders': state_tracker/st_program.c:735: warning: 'sh' may be used uninitialized in this function
| * r300/compiler: Use rc_get_readers_normal() for presubtract optimizationsTom Stellard2010-10-271-175/+118
| |
| * i965: Add bit operation support to the fragment shader backend.Kenneth Graunke2010-10-271-3/+12
| |
| * i965: Make FS uniforms be the actual type of the uniform at upload time.Eric Anholt2010-10-276-9/+81
| | | | | | | | | | | | | | | | This fixes some insanity that would otherwise be required for GLSL 1.30 bit ops or gen6 integer uniform operations in general, at the cost of upload-time pain. Given that we only have that pain because mesa's mangling our integer uniforms to be floats, this something that should be fixed outside of the shader codegen.
| * intel: Enable GL_EXT_separate_shader_objects in Intel driversIan Romanick2010-10-271-0/+2
| |
| * swrast: Enable GL_EXT_separate_shader_objects in software pathsIan Romanick2010-10-271-0/+1
| |
| * Track separate programs for each stageIan Romanick2010-10-2713-115/+297
| | | | | | | | | | The assumption is that all stages are the same program or that varyings are passed between stages using built-in varyings.
| * mesa: Track an ActiveProgram distinct from CurrentProgramIan Romanick2010-10-274-48/+73
| | | | | | | | | | ActiveProgram is the GL_EXT_separate_shader_objects state variable used for glUniform calls. glUseProgram also sets this.
| * mesa: Add display list support for GL_EXT_separate_shader_objects functionsIan Romanick2010-10-271-0/+44
| |
| * mesa: Skeletal support for GL_EXT_separate_shader_objectsIan Romanick2010-10-272-0/+110
| | | | | | | | | | Really just filling in the entry points. None of them do anything other than validate their inputs.
| * mesa: Add infrastructure to track GL_EXT_separate_shader_objectsIan Romanick2010-10-272-0/+2
| |
| * glapi: Commit files changed by previous commitIan Romanick2010-10-2710-5840/+6027
| |
| * glapi: Add GL_EXT_separate_shader_objectsIan Romanick2010-10-273-0/+30
| |
| * Fix build on systems where "python" is python 3.Kenneth Graunke2010-10-274-8/+8
| | | | | | | | | | | | | | | | | | | | | | First, it changes autoconf to use a "python2" binary when available, rather than plain "python" (which is ambiguous). Secondly, it changes the Makefiles to use $(PYTHON) $(PYTHON_FLAGS) rather than calling python directly. Signed-off-by: Xavier Chantry <[email protected]> Signed-off-by: Matthew William Cox <[email protected]> Signed-off-by: Kenneth Graunke <[email protected]>
| * r300g: add a default channel ordering of texture border for unhandled formatsMarek Olšák2010-10-271-9/+5
| | | | | | | | | | It should fix the texture border for compressed textures. Broken since 8449a4772a73f613d9425b691cffba6a261df813.
| * r600c: add missing radeon_prepare_render() call on evergreenAlex Deucher2010-10-271-0/+4
| |
| * r100: revalidate after radeon_update_renderbuffersAlex Deucher2010-10-272-0/+4
| | | | | | | | | | | | | | This is a port of 603741a86df0e43c0b52e8c202a35c7fe2fc1d9c to r100. Signed-off-by: Alex Deucher <[email protected]>
| * swrast: Print out format on unexpected failure in _swrast_ReadPixels.Vinson Lee2010-10-271-1/+1
| |
| * egl: Remove unnecessary headers.Vinson Lee2010-10-273-4/+0
| |
| * mesa: Remove unnecessary header.Vinson Lee2010-10-271-1/+0
| |
| * st/mesa: Remove unnecessary header.Vinson Lee2010-10-271-1/+0
| |
| * r600g: Silence uninitialized variable warnings.Vinson Lee2010-10-271-4/+4
| |
| * mesa: Remove unnecessary headers.Vinson Lee2010-10-271-2/+0
| |
| * r300g: Silence uninitialized variable warning.Vinson Lee2010-10-271-0/+5
| | | | | | | | | | | | | | Fixes this GCC warning. r300_state_derived.c: In function 'r300_update_derived_state': r300_state_derived.c:593: warning: 'r' may be used uninitialized in this function r300_state_derived.c:593: note: 'r' was declared here
| * r600g: Destroy the blitter.Tilman Sauerbeck2010-10-271-0/+2
| | | | | | | | | | | | This fix got lost in the state rework merge. Signed-off-by: Tilman Sauerbeck <[email protected]>
| * r600g: In radeon_bo(), call LIST_INITHEAD early.Tilman Sauerbeck2010-10-271-1/+1
| | | | | | | | | | | | | | | | radeon_bo_destroy() will want to read the list field. Without this patch, we'd end up evaluating the list pointers before they have been properly set up when we destroyed the newly created bo if it cannot be mapped. Signed-off-by: Tilman Sauerbeck <[email protected]>
| * mesa: rename function to _mesa_is_format_integer_color()Brian Paul2010-10-265-6/+6
| | | | | | | | Be a bit more clear about its operation.
| * mesa: fix bug in _mesa_is_format_integer()Brian Paul2010-10-261-2/+5
| | | | | | | | | | | | We only want to return true if it's an integer _color_ format, not a depth and/or stencil format. Fixes http://bugs.freedesktop.org/show_bug.cgi?id=31143
| * mesa: remove the unused _mesa_is_fragment_shader_active() functionBrian Paul2010-10-261-12/+0
| | | | | | | | This reverts commit 013d5ffeec3af5665c81c6a7a8370d21699ca609.